1Industrial Air Purifier Market Global Analysis
In recent years, environmental pollution
levels soared immensely on account of
industrial expansion. While pollution has varied
forms, air pollution contributes to around 6.7
million deaths globally each year. Estimates
indicate China and India witnessed the highest
number of deaths in 2019, reaching about 1.8
million and 1.7 million, respectively. The
alarming surge in air pollution is thus expected
to boost the global industrial air purifier
market.
Besides, industrial workers, especially in
developing regions, face occupational risks of
COPD and lung cancer due to a lack of safety
standards and high PM 2.5 concentrations. As per
WHO, occupational risks like airborne
particles result in around 13 of COPD
cases. Our estimates indicate that the global
industrial air purifier market will advance with
a CAGR of 7.06 over the forecast period
2022-2028. Air Purification Stimulates
Industrial Expansion While air pollution severely
impacts human health, it has a heavy economic
impact, equating to approximately 3.3 of the
worlds GDP. As per industry sources, in 2018,
disability due to chronic
2- diseases resulted in an economic loss of around
200 billion globally. Global air pollution
concerns have influenced end-user sectors to
deploy molecular and particulate filters to curb
emissions - The Food Beverage category is expected to
witness the fastest growth in the end-user
segment. This is mainly attributed to the need
for extremely hygienic conditions to prevent
contamination in processing plants. Molecular
filters are widely employed to collect
volatile chemicals, fumes, and gases using
activated carbon beds in FB processing plants.
Since these cleaners are specially designed
to prevent contamination, companies like
Camfil AB have introduced CC 6000 ProSafe air
purifiers, especially for FB and life
science industries. - The Power category dominates within the end-user
segment, garnering the highest shares. The surged
energy requirements in developed and developing
regions have soared filtration systems demand to
maintain airflow. Air compressors, in this
scenario, are critical for the processing units
to remain operational for prolonged periods
without shutdowns. This has elevated the demand
for new filter technologies to enhance
performance. For instance, a coal mining
company in Chinas Shanxi Province adopted
Anguils new air filter to capture
ventilation air methane and convert it into
electricity. - The Metal Processing industry generates
high-level contaminants from metal grinding - and cutting, leading to a prevalence of
respiratory diseases among workers. Compact air
purifier emerges as a major segment, contributing
around 37.08 in 2021. Since these purifiers
offer air extraction and cleaning of large
volumes of space, their demand has advanced
immensely in the industry. Estimates
suggest that around 100 million
metalworking fluids are generated annually
in the US, affecting over one million
employees. These factors have increased air
cleaners demand, thereby driving the North
America industrial air purifier market. - Government Measures Widen Market Scope
- Several government bodies have enforced
regulatory measures to maintain the industrial
air quality in order to protect employees from
adverse working conditions. These measures have
thus fueled the adoption of air filters,
majorly driving the market in the
Asia-Pacific, Europe, and North America. - The Occupational Safety and Health Administration
recommended guidelines to maintain the indoor air
quality in the US and Canada. - Canadas government introduced the Federal
Sustainable Development Strategy 2019 to - 2022, which outlines sustainability actions
in collaboration with partners to tackle
air pollution. - In India, the Department of Science
Technology launched the Indigenous Photonic
System for Real Time Remote Monitoring of Air
Quality project to develop deployable air - quality monitoring photonic system.
- The German government aims to reduce greenhouse
gas emissions by around 55 by 2030 under the
Climate Action Programme and the Climate Action
Act. It states annual reduction targets for
individual industries. - Future Prospects of Air Purification Tech
3As per Greenpeace Southeast Asia and the Centre
for Research on Energy and Clean Air, air
pollution accounts for about 2.9 trillion in
economic cost globally. This factor and its
detrimental impact on health have created
possibilities for technological advancements
in air purification systems. For instance,
IoT-connected air filtration systems and growth
in the portable cleaners market are making great
strides, from polar ionization to the use of
nanofibers. Furthermore, filterless magnetic
air purification deploys a tri-stage
micro-trapping method combining polarization,
impingement, and accumulation for a trap and
kill outcome to eliminate secondary pollutants
activation in enclosed industrial spaces.
Therefore, the development and deployment of
smart and cost-effective filtration technology
will be a major driving factor for the global
industrial air purifier market over the forecast
period.
